Personal Loan Origination Fees Cost More Than the Sticker Price

Most borrowers focus on the interest rate and ignore the origination fee. That mistake can add hundreds of dollars to the real cost of a loan. The APR tells a fuller story, but only if you know how to read it.

An Origination Fee Is a Prepaid Interest Charge, Not an Administrative Courtesy

Lenders charge origination fees to compensate for underwriting, processing, and funding a loan. The fee is expressed as a percentage of the gross loan amount, typically between 1% and 10%, and deducted from your proceeds at disbursement. You never see that money, but you repay interest on the full principal as if you did.

That structure is the core problem. A borrower who takes a $20,000 personal loan with a 6% origination fee receives $18,800. The lender keeps $1,200 on day one. Monthly payments, however, are calculated on the full $20,000 balance. The origination fee effectively raises the true cost of borrowed capital above the stated interest rate.

How to Calculate the Dollar Cost of an Origination Fee

The formula is direct. Multiply the gross loan amount by the origination fee percentage. The result is your upfront cost in dollars.

Origination Fee in Dollars = Gross Loan Amount x Origination Fee Rate

That dollar figure is not your total added cost, though. Because you pay interest on money you never received, the compounding effect extends the damage across the full loan term.

To find the total interest-adjusted cost of the origination fee, use this three-step process:

  1. Calculate the origination fee in dollars: Gross Loan x Fee Rate.
  2. Estimate the interest paid on the withheld amount over the loan term using the standard amortization formula.
  3. Add those two figures together.

For most borrowers, step two produces a result between 40% and 65% of the origination fee itself, depending on the interest rate and term length.

Worked Example 1: A $10,000 Loan With a 3% Origination Fee

A borrower takes a $10,000 personal loan at 11.5% APR over 48 months. The lender charges a 3% origination fee.

  • Origination fee in dollars: $10,000 x 0.03 = $300
  • Net proceeds received: $10,000 - $300 = $9,700
  • Monthly payment on $10,000 at 11.5% over 48 months: $260.66
  • Total repaid: $260.66 x 48 = $12,511.68
  • Total interest paid: $12,511.68 - $10,000 = $2,511.68

Now compare that to a loan of $9,700 at 11.5% over 48 months, which is what the borrower actually received.

  • Monthly payment on $9,700 at 11.5% over 48 months: $252.84
  • Total repaid: $252.84 x 48 = $12,136.32
  • Total interest paid: $12,136.32 - $9,700 = $2,436.32

The borrower pays $2,511.68 in interest but only received $9,700. The difference in interest cost attributable to the origination fee structure: $75.36. Add the $300 fee itself, and the total true cost of that origination fee is $375.36, not $300.

Worked Example 2: A $25,000 Loan With an 8% Origination Fee

This scenario represents a borrower with moderate credit risk taking a larger loan. The lender charges an 8% origination fee.

  • Gross loan amount: $25,000
  • Origination fee: $25,000 x 0.08 = $2,000
  • Net proceeds: $25,000 - $2,000 = $23,000
  • Interest rate: 19.99% APR, 60-month term
  • Monthly payment on $25,000 at 19.99% over 60 months: $662.56
  • Total repaid: $662.56 x 60 = $39,753.60
  • Total interest on $25,000: $39,753.60 - $25,000 = $14,753.60

If the same borrower had borrowed only $23,000 at 19.99% over 60 months:

  • Monthly payment: $609.55
  • Total repaid: $609.55 x 60 = $36,573.00
  • Total interest on $23,000: $36,573.00 - $23,000 = $13,573.00

Interest difference attributable to the fee structure: $14,753.60 - $13,573.00 = $1,180.60. Add the $2,000 origination fee itself. Total true cost of the origination fee: $3,180.60, not $2,000. The borrower paid 59% more in real cost than the headline fee number suggested.

Why APR Captures the Fee but Misleads on Net Proceeds

The Annual Percentage Rate incorporates origination fees into its calculation per Regulation Z requirements. A loan with a 15% stated interest rate and a 5% origination fee will carry an APR meaningfully above 15%. APR is the correct metric for comparing two loans of the same term length.

APR does not tell you how much money you will actually receive on funding day. For any loan with an origination fee, calculate net proceeds separately before accepting terms. Net proceeds equal gross loan amount minus origination fee in dollars.

Borrowers who need a specific net amount, say $18,000 to consolidate credit card debt, must gross up the loan request to account for the origination fee. At a 5% fee, requesting $18,000 nets only $17,100. To receive $18,000, the borrower must request $18,947.37 (calculated as $18,000 divided by 0.95).

How to Compare Two Loans With Different Fee Structures

Lenders price origination fees and interest rates as a trade-off. A loan with a 1% origination fee often carries a higher interest rate than a loan with a 5% fee from the same lender. Short-term borrowers benefit from lower fees. Long-term borrowers benefit from lower rates.

Use this comparison framework:

  • Calculate total repaid (monthly payment x number of payments) for each loan option.
  • Subtract net proceeds received from total repaid for each option.
  • The option with the lower total cost is cheaper for your specific term, regardless of which fee or rate looks attractive in isolation.

Do not compare rates across different term lengths. A 36-month loan and a 60-month loan with the same APR produce very different total costs.

The Correct Way to Account for Origination Fees Before Signing

Before accepting any personal loan offer, run four numbers: gross loan amount, origination fee in dollars, net proceeds, and total repaid over the full term. Those four figures define the true cost of the transaction.

Lenders are required to disclose APR and finance charges in the loan agreement under the Truth in Lending Act. The finance charge line item in that disclosure includes the origination fee. Cross-reference the finance charge against your own calculation to confirm the lender's math.

If two offers have the same net proceeds and same term length, choose the lower APR. If they differ on term length, use total repaid as the tie-breaker.
